Two Similar Systems

Both ETIAS and ESTA are electronic travel authorizations for visa-exempt travelers. They serve the same purpose: pre-screening visitors before they arrive, without requiring a full visa application.

If you have used ESTA to visit the United States, the ETIAS process will feel familiar. There are some key differences worth understanding.

Full Comparison

ETIAS (Europe)ESTA (USA)
TypeTravel authorizationTravel authorization
Cost€20$21 (→$40 in 2026)
Validity3 years2 years
Max Stay90 days / 180 days90 days per visit
Countries30 Schengen statesUSA only
Age ExemptionsUnder 18/over 70 freeNo exemptions
ProcessingMinutes to 30 daysMinutes to 72 hours
ApplicationOnline onlyOnline only
Launch DateQ4 20262009 (operational)

The European Travel Information and Authorisation System (ETIAS) is a new pre-travel authorization for visa-exempt visitors to Europe's Schengen Area. It covers 30 countries with a single authorization.

ETIAS costs €20 for adults (free for under 18 and over 70), is valid for 3 years, and allows stays of up to 90 days within any 180-day period.

What They Have in Common

  • Online application process

  • Pre-travel requirement (apply before boarding)

  • Security screening against databases

  • Multiple entries allowed

  • Not a visa — does not guarantee entry

  • Linked electronically to passport

Key Differences

  • Age exemptions: ETIAS is free for under 18/over 70; ESTA has no exemptions

  • Validity: ETIAS lasts 3 years; ESTA lasts 2 years

  • Stay calculation: ETIAS uses rolling 90/180 days; ESTA is 90 days per visit

  • Coverage: ETIAS covers 30 countries; ESTA covers only the USA

  • Processing: ETIAS may take up to 30 days; ESTA rarely exceeds 72 hours

Comparison FAQs

Do I need both ETIAS and ESTA?
Only if traveling to both regions. ETIAS is for Europe (Schengen), ESTA is for the USA. They are separate systems operated by different authorities.
Is it the same application process?
Very similar — both are online forms asking for personal, passport, and security information. ETIAS includes more background questions but the format is comparable.
Which one costs more?
ESTA will cost more ($40) than ETIAS (€20) once the new ESTA fee takes effect in 2026. Plus, ETIAS is free for travelers under 18 or over 70.
Can I use ETIAS to visit the USA or ESTA to visit Europe?
No. They are completely separate systems. ETIAS is only valid for Schengen countries; ESTA is only valid for the United States.
Which one is valid longer?
ETIAS (3 years) is valid longer than ESTA (2 years), though both are subject to passport expiry.
